Several plain objectives in God's intervention on Israel's behalf against Gog and his barbarian allies, and in the ensuing terrible fire sent forth by the Lord in Ezekiel 39:6, are now made clear:
- That the "house of Israel" Ezekiel 39:29, that is, the Jews, will now have demonstrable confirmation in the realm of temporal affairs (additional to the Spirit's transformation of their hearts to repent and seek forgiveness in Christ alone)1 that Jesus is none other the LORD of Hosts, their Messiah, the Holy One in Israel to Whom they were blinded;2 for God the Father has magnified His Word above all His Name, and who is His Word but the Logos, that is, The Son, Jesus Christ? Therefore, making known the Lord’s holy Name (as the verse says) in the midst of Israel is a full revelation of Jesus as Messiah to the Jews and is also a nationwide saving act of God bestowed upon the Jewish people at that time (and not just in Israel, but to the Jews worldwide).
- That the Lord will not just redeem that generation of Jews, but will maintain the Jewish people continually within the broader
church right through to His coming, because this verse promises that the Lord "will not let them pollute my holy name any more".
"For this is as the waters of Noah unto me: for as I have sworn that the waters of Noah should no more go over the earth; So have I sworn that I would not be wroth with thee nor rebuke thee. For the mountains shall depart, and the hills be removed; but my kindness shall not depart from thee, neither shall the covenant of my peace be removed, saith the LORD that hath mercy on thee." (Isaiah 54:5 - NOTE that these blessings upon Israel fall when it is drawn back to the Messianic faith and therefore, being joined to the Gentile church transcendent at that time, the same blessing matrix applies to the non-Jewish members of the church; accordingly, the coming Philadelphian church era will entail no more grand temporal judgments upon the (increasingly godly) nations).
This point is again made clear at the end of this chapter of Ezekiel (Ezekiel 39:29). - That the heathen, that is, the barbarian nations of the East primarily, but the ungodly of the West both secondarily and by inference, will know that Jesus Himself is the Holy One in the now Messianic nation of Israel; that is, the conversion of the Jews will not be concealed to the world beyond, but become a global talking point; this is expressed again in Ezekiel 39:21 and Ezekiel 39:23.
- That God's covenant Name ("Yah-weh"), hitherto "profaned" by the vileness of the Jews in every land whithersoever they have been scattered, will be conversely sanctified in the conversion to Christ of the Jews (see Ezekiel 39:26).

As Ezekiel 39:21-29 (the sweet and joyous epitaph to the Gog-led attack on Israel) shows, it will be a Reformational Christian nation of Israel that the Lord will deliver, because a state of happy reconciliation to God is celebrated in the text along with a promise of unbroken, continuous abiding in His favour rather than in His displeasure as hitherto; and there can be no reconciliation with God absent being in Christ, as follows:
"To wit, that God was in Christ, reconciling the world unto himself, not imputing their trespasses unto them; and hath committed unto us the word of reconciliation." (2 Corinthians 5:19)
Likewise, there can be no true conversion to Jesus absent the new nature imparted by God in a sovereign and undeserved act of His elective mercy in which
He unilaterally gives a heart of saving faith to enable the sinner to come to Christ.
Whereas the Antigospel of Arminianism (which has eclipsed the gospel of grace amidst ostensible Protestantism since the dreadful apostasy of the 1800s
began) holds that the new birth is a consequence of coming to Christ for salvation, the Reformational gospel of grace holds that no man can come to
Christ without first being born again and having a new heart willing to have Jesus be his Saviour; under the popular Arminian model of today, the sinner
is utterly graceless and latently hostile to Jesus when asking to be saved!
The coming conversion of the Jews will show this microscopic reality on a grand, macroscopic scale, as follows:
"A new heart also will I give you, and a new spirit will I put within you: and I will take away the stony heart out of your flesh, and I will give you an heart of flesh. And I will put my spirit within you, and cause you to walk in my statutes, and ye shall keep my judgments, and do them." (Ezekiel 36:26-27)
Walking in God's statutes is no less than the exercise of faith (without which it is impossible to please God (Hebrews 11:6)) and, as can be seen from
the passage above, is caused by the indwelling of the Spirit of God and follows upon the creation, by God, in the sinner of a new "heart of flesh",
one that is inclined to loving and serving God.
